WebFeb 17, 2024 · Although the hair coils are only 1.5 inches in diameter they can stretch easily to the size you need. If they over-stretch, simply place them in warm water or use a hairdryer to shrink them... WebNov 24, 2024 · If a coil tie seems to not snap back to its original size, just give it a bath in some cold water! It will shrink back and be just like new. The smooth finish of the plastic …
